The area in short neighbourhood AI summary

Motspur Park is a neighbourhood in London with a population of 9,315. The median house price is £645,000, with 175 sales recorded over 12 months and prices rising 17.2% over five years.

Read the full area story →

Detached properties command £820,000 median; semi-detached homes £715,000; terraced £518,750; and flats £395,000. About 75% of neighbourhoods in England are more deprived. The median age is 43.8, and 74.3% of homes are owner-occupied. The area is served by the Royal Borough of Kingston upon Thames, with council tax band D at £2,608.12. Air quality is moderate, with no flood risk. Broadband is excellent: 99.2% have superfast connectivity and 91.7% gigabit access. One conservation area (Presburg Road) and two listed buildings are present. The area has 48.0% of residents with level 4 qualifications or higher.
